Android 4.0下开发指南针应用源码指南
版权申诉
110 浏览量
更新于2024-10-21
收藏 1.59MB ZIP 举报
资源摘要信息:"本文档提供了在Android 4.0系统环境下,开发指南针应用的源码示例。源码文件名为CompassTest,并可适配于Nexus 4设备上运行。该指南针应用的开发涉及到了Android平台下的位置服务和传感器API的使用。开发者可以参考这份源码来学习如何获取设备的方向信息,并将其展示在界面上。文档中也包含了一个名为JavaApk源码说明.txt的文本文件,其内容应为源码使用说明和开发指南针应用的步骤解析。此外,资源列表中还包含了一个点这里查看更多优质源码~.url文件,可能指向更多相关的源码资源网站或页面。"
详细知识点说明:
1. 安卓源码(Android Source Code)概念:
安卓源码是指用于构建Android操作系统的所有源代码,它基于Linux内核,采用Java语言编写,并包含了大量的本地代码。开发者通常通过下载和查看这些源码来了解Android系统的底层架构、系统服务以及API的实现方式。该文件提供的源码是针对特定版本Android 4.0的开发示例。
2. Android 4.0操作系统:
Android 4.0(代号“冰淇淋三明治”)是Android操作系统的一个重要版本,它首次统一了手机和平板电脑的用户界面。Android 4.0引入了多项新功能,如人脸解锁、数据使用统计、增强的通知系统等。了解Android 4.0的开发环境对于兼容老版本的设备非常重要,尤其是考虑到它支持的硬件标准。
3. 指南针应用开发:
指南针应用是利用设备内置的磁力计传感器来实现的。开发者需要编写代码来获取传感器数据,并将这些数据转换为用户可读的方向信息。Android开发中,通常使用Sensor API来访问磁力计传感器数据。本源码文件“CompassTest”应展示了如何获取这些数据,并将指南针指针绘制在应用界面上。
4. Nexus 4设备:
Nexus 4是由LG为谷歌生产的智能手机,作为Google Nexus系列的一部分,它通常搭载最新的Android操作系统,并提供良好的性能与开发支持。它使用的是高通骁龙S4 Pro处理器,4.7英寸的True HD IPS显示屏,并且支持4G LTE网络。在Android开发中,Nexus系列设备常作为测试和验证设备。
5. Java语言应用开发:
在Android开发中,Java语言是主要的编程语言之一。源码文件中的Java代码是实现Android应用逻辑的核心部分。使用Java进行Android应用开发,可以利用Android SDK提供的丰富API和工具。
6. 源码使用说明(JavaApk源码说明.txt):
这个文件提供了关于如何使用指南针应用源码的具体指南。通常包括项目的结构说明、关键代码解释、开发步骤和测试说明等内容。开发者应仔细阅读此文件,以便正确理解和应用源码。
7. 开源代码的合法使用:
本文档提到了免责声明,表明资料来源于合法渠道,尊重原创作者或出版方,不承担版权问题或内容的法律责任。在使用源码时,开发者应当遵守相关的版权法规,尊重原作者的劳动成果。如果有源码来源于互联网,开发者应确保不侵犯第三方的版权权益,并在必要时进行适当的引用或归功。
8. 压缩包子文件的文件名称列表:
- JavaApk源码说明.txt:包含对指南针源码项目的详细说明文档。
- 点这里查看更多优质源码~.url:一个网页链接文件,可能指向更广泛的优质开源代码资源,方便开发者进一步查找和下载其他相关的代码库。
2022-03-06 上传
2021-10-11 上传
2021-11-17 上传
2021-10-10 上传
2021-12-04 上传
2021-10-14 上传
2021-12-04 上传
2021-10-13 上传
2023-04-06 上传
金枝玉叶9
- 粉丝: 195
- 资源: 7637
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查